Location: Miami
Department: Safety Laboratory
About Us
Evolution Research Group (ERG) is a leading U.S.-based, privately held, independent clinical research site company and provider of clinical development services, with expertise in early- and late-stage neuroscience drug development. With 20 wholly owned clinical sites and 4 affiliated sites, ERG conducts in-patient and out-patient Phase I-IV clinical research studies across a wide range of therapeutic areas.
To support the continued growth of our Phase I business, ERG operates CLIA-certified, GLP-compliant safety laboratories integrated with our early-phase clinical operations. These laboratories provide high-quality, timely safety testing to support first-in-human and other early-phase clinical trials.
Job Description
The Laboratory Technician, Clinical Research (CLIA/GLP) supports the daily operational activities of ERG's clinical research safety laboratory. This role is responsible for specimen handling, laboratory testing, documentation, and equipment maintenance in accordance with CLIA, GLP, GCP, SOPs, OSHA standards, and applicable regulatory requirements.
The Laboratory Technician works under the supervision of laboratory leadership and collaborates closely with clinical and research teams to ensure accurate, timely, and compliant laboratory results in support of clinical trials.
Key Responsibilities
Laboratory Operations
- Perform routine laboratory testing and procedures in accordance with established SOPs, protocols, and quality standards.
- Process, label, prepare, and store biological specimens per protocol and regulatory requirements.
- Ensure accurate and timely documentation of laboratory activities, test results, and quality records.
- Assist with sample shipment to reference laboratories in compliance with protocol, sponsor, and regulatory requirements.
Compliance & Quality
- Adhere to CLIA, GLP, GCP, IRB, OSHA, and applicable state and federal regulations at all times.
- Support inspection and audit readiness by maintaining an organized, compliant, and inspection-ready laboratory environment.
- Participate in quality control, quality assurance, and proficiency testing activities as assigned.
- Promptly report deviations, errors, or equipment issues to laboratory leadership.
Equipment & Supplies
- Perform routine equipment maintenance, calibration checks, and cleaning per SOPs.
- Monitor laboratory inventory levels and assist with restocking supplies.
- Ensure proper storage and handling of reagents, controls, and specimens.
Collaboration & Support
- Work closely with clinical staff to support study-related laboratory needs.
- Communicate effectively with laboratory leadership regarding workload, issues, and priorities.
- Participate in training, competency assessments, and continuing education as required.
Skills and Qualifications
Required
- Associate or Bachelor of Science degree in a laboratory science or related field.
- Prior experience in a clinical, medical, or research laboratory setting preferred.
- Basic understanding of laboratory safety practices and regulatory compliance expectations.
